A gentle walk through the heart of Suffolk’s countryside. Visit Combs Wood, an ancient woodland where bluebells abound.

This 6 ½ mile walk starts and ends at Stowmarket Railway Station and follows the Gipping Valley Path along the lovely River Gipping. Combs Wood is an excellent example of an ancient woodland and is recorded in the Doomsday Book. Near the end of the walk pas by Badley Hall, with its atmosphere of past splendour.

Directions to start: Stowmarket is located on the A14 between Ipswich and Bury St Edmunds.

Start Nat GR TM051588.
